Transaction 37bab59bc11fdce9ae8aea348d68955d0ee295a739be4790782d4150190718b6

1 Input
2 Outputs
  • 37bab59bc11fdce9ae8aea348d68955d0ee295a739be4790782d4150190718b6:0
  • value  92057267
    address  39ecCUXf5zaeUSQvFd41e4PL4iHKCQiCGr
  • 37bab59bc11fdce9ae8aea348d68955d0ee295a739be4790782d4150190718b6:1
  • value  1378688
    address  3LgV7hRtqq2DE6vF7TDddDWoGAedLVEeRC